Step-by-Step Guide: Applying Cutting Stickers
Alright, so you've got your awesome new cutting stickers and you're ready to get them on your Carry! Here's a step-by-step guide to make sure you get it right. First, gather your materials. You'll need your stickers, a squeegee or credit card, masking tape, a measuring tape, a clean cloth, and some soapy water. Prep your surface. Clean the area where you'll be applying the sticker. Make sure it's free of dirt, dust, and grease. Use the soapy water to clean the area and make sure that it's squeaky clean. Then, dry it thoroughly. Measure and position your sticker. Use the measuring tape and masking tape to find the perfect spot for your sticker. This is important, so take your time and make sure everything is aligned properly. Tape the sticker in place with the masking tape. Apply the sticker. Peel off the backing paper, being careful not to let the sticker touch the surface. Use the squeegee or credit card to smooth out any air bubbles, working from the center outward. Slowly peel off the transfer tape, making sure the sticker adheres to the surface. If any part of the sticker doesn't stick, use the squeegee to press it down again. If you have any problems, then you can start over. Once the sticker is in place, you are all done. How cool!
Tips for a Perfect Application
Let's get some pro tips, shall we? Before applying the sticker, make sure the surface is completely clean and dry. Dirt or grease can prevent the sticker from sticking properly. If you are having trouble then you can try using masking tape to help with alignment and positioning. Apply the sticker slowly and carefully to avoid air bubbles. If you see air bubbles, then use the squeegee to smooth them out immediately. If you're working with a large sticker, then work in sections to prevent wrinkles. It's also better to apply stickers in a cool, dry environment to avoid heat-related issues. Patience is key! Don't rush the process, and take your time. If you're not confident, then you can always seek professional help. If you do not feel that you can do it, then hire a professional. This can save you a lot of time and money in the long run!
Maintaining Your Cutting Stickers
Once your cutting stickers are on, you want to keep them looking their best. Here are some maintenance tips. First, av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ners when washing your vehicle. This can damage the stickers. Use mild soap and water and a soft cloth for cleaning. If you spot any lifting edges or bubbles, then smooth them out immediately. Small issues can become bigger problems if they are left unattended. When washing your car, avoid using high-pressure water jets directly on the stickers. This can cause them to peel. Instead, use a gentle spray or wash by hand. Protect your stickers from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ures, if possible. Prolonged exposure can cause fading or damage over time. You can also apply a wax or sealant over the stickers to provide extra protection. This will help them last longer and maintain their vibrant appearance.
